    I recently encountered an issue with the Open Currency Converter by Joe Hawes plugin. When activated, it broke my website’s layout, setting a fixed max width of 700px on all pages and causing some CSS to break as well. I suspect that the plugin may no longer be compatible with the latest version of Elementor, as this issue occurred after a recent update.

    For now, I’ve deactivated the plugin to prevent further display issues on the site. Could you kindly provide assistance in fixing this problem or confirm if there are any compatibility issues?

    I use the plugin specifically for our pricing page and rely on it for the Currency Exchange Converter feature, so I hope to resolve this promptly.

    I successfully troubleshooted the issue. It turns out the problem was related to the Hello Elementor theme. After updating it, all of my custom PHP codes—used to create Options Pages and Shortcodes for my ACF Repeater to handle more advanced and dynamic currency conversion—were erased. As a result, the site broke because the shortcodes, where the Open Currency Converter plugin was applied, were unavailable and couldn’t function properly.
